Our world class Regulatory Market Access and Compliance Practice has unparalleled experience in gaining access to established and emerging markets for technologies globally by providing regulatory analysis, obtaining national authorisations and licenses for services or equipment and then ensuring on-going regulatory compliance whilst providing predictive analysis about upcoming risks and opportunities for technologies in those markets. We are looking for people with experience and knowledge of the satellite, space and telecommunications sector.
